Scissor-folded pushchairs are among the most well-known. They are typically lightweight and get their name from the way they fold down into a long rectangular shape similar to closing the scissors. They are simple to use, however they aren't always easy to fit in smaller car boot spaces. They might not be suitable for children because they don't lie flat.

The umbrella-folded pushchairs, however are smaller as they fold in a similar way to a brolly. They are generally easier to use and can be operated using only one hand. However, removing the seat unit from the chassis is a bit fiddly. Some brands, like UPPAbaby have a unique G Luxe model which can also be folded and unfolded using one hand. This is a great benefit for parents who are busy.

The way the pushchair locks into place when folded may impact its usefulness. Some lock into place automatically, while others include a clip that requires to be fastened. If you intend to travel with your stroller you should look for one that can be locked when it is in its folded position.

There are many things to think about when selecting a pushchair. Size, design, and features like three-wheeled, compatibility for multiple kids or auto-folding are crucial factors. However, the mechanism for folding is also crucial as it can affect how well your buggy will fit into your lifestyle.

The way that your buggy collapses will make a significant difference to your daily life, regardless of whether you choose an umbrella fold or a scissor folding. Umbrella-folded pushchairs, which are generally lightweight strollers, get their name because they collapse like brolly. You just lift a lever or switch at the rear of the buggy and it folds into itself and the top part folding over the lower half. They can be folded with one hand, which is great for holding your baby and the juggling bags.

Another great alternative is a model with a scissor fold, such as the Le Clerc Influencer XL. These pushchairs feature a scissor-like fold, which means they fold down into a square-ish form. They are easy to fold however they tend to be larger than umbrella-fold pushchairs, when folded which means they won't fit into smaller car boot.

If you're using your pushchair for a travel system with a carrycot then it's worth making sure that the seat has a lie-flat recline. Newborns should lie flat in order to ensure good lung and spinal development and a pushchair that does not provide this might not be suitable from birth.
